Many
in our own community cope with the daily
challenge of maintaining their very lives in the
face of HIV/AIDS. This disease and the
side effects of medication for the disease can
prevent adequate nutritional intake which
quickly leads to the loss of total body weight
and lean body mass, malnutrition, reduced immune
function and finally, the invasion of
potentially fatal opportunistic infections.
Its victims struggle with the challenge despite
sickness and the financial choice between
critical medication and food.
In
October 1998, Moveable Feast Lexington, Inc was
created by a small group of caring and dedicated
individuals to meet the nutritional needs of these
sufferers. With very little public funding,
through the generosity of our faith based
communities and individuals like you, Moveable Feast
is now into it's ninth year of preparing and
delivering hot, nutritional meals to men,
women and children who continue to struggle with
this disease as well as individuals who are in
Hospice Care due to any terminal illness.
